Glutinous rice balls are sweet and sticky, with a very good taste and chewiness. The cores are of various kinds, such as black sesame, peanuts, red beans, fresh meat, etc., and the outer skin can be made into colorful glutinous rice balls, which are very beautiful. How to cook quick-frozen glutinous rice balls

1. Boil the water in the pot first.

2. Then gently put the raw glutinous rice balls into the pot and stir them with a spoon to prevent them from sticking to the pot. When the dumplings float up, add cold water. Repeat twice. When all the dumplings have floated up, they are ready to be served.

3. If you leave it in the pot without taking it out, it will become mushy if left for too long. If you want the glutinous rice balls to taste better, you might as well cook the soup and the glutinous rice balls separately. If you want sweet fillings, just add a little sugar to the soup.

4. If the filling is salty such as fresh meat, the soup can be richer. Ingredients such as vegetables and seaweed can be added to the soup. You can put the cooked glutinous rice balls directly in the soup and enjoy them.

The correct way to cook quick-frozen glutinous rice balls

1. Cut the glutinous rice balls packaging bag and let them thaw at room temperature for four to five minutes.

2. Bring the water to a boil. When the water is boiling, pour it into a bowl and set it aside to cool. The amount of water used to cook the glutinous rice balls should be more rather than less.

3. After the water boils, put the quick-frozen glutinous rice balls bought from the supermarket into the boiling water. Gently put the glutinous rice balls in one by one, remember not to pour the whole bag in at once, and do not push them with a spoon or chopsticks immediately, as this will easily break them.

4. To prevent the glutinous rice balls from sticking to the pot, use a spoon to slowly stir the pot to prevent the water from boiling and lifting the lid.

5. To cook glutinous rice balls, you must master the method of "putting them in boiling water and simmering them over low heat". After putting the glutinous rice balls into the pot, turn down the heat, or add a little cold water, and let the water remain in a state of neither boiling nor half boiling. Continue for about 5 minutes. Open the lid of the pot and you will see that all the glutinous rice balls are floating on the water. The surface of the glutinous rice balls looks relatively smooth, and they are elastic when pressed with chopsticks.

6. Pour the bowl of water placed next to the pot into a circle. The clearer the soup is, the better it tastes. When serving, do not have too little soup to prevent the dumplings from sticking together, and do not have too much soup to be careful of burning your hands.

7. When all the glutinous rice balls float up, turn down the heat and pour in a small spoonful of water. When it boils again, add a little more water. Repeat this process 3 times or more. When the glutinous rice balls become soft, you can take them out. At this time, the glutinous rice balls are basically cooked and can be eaten. You must master this time when cooking the glutinous rice balls to prevent them from breaking.

How to cook frozen glutinous rice balls without breaking them

In the past, when I cooked quick-frozen glutinous rice balls, some of them would always break. Later, I found some methods, so that they would basically not break. First of all, before cooking the quick-frozen glutinous rice balls, you should check whether they are broken. If they are broken, of course, the filling will be exposed after they are put into the pot. Then, when cooking the glutinous rice balls, you should gently stir them when putting them in to prevent them from sinking to the bottom of the pot and sticking, which will cause them to break when cooked. Finally, you should not cook them for too long, otherwise the glutinous rice balls will burst directly and the filling will be exposed.
